I stitched all 4 pieces with one right side and one wrong side together instead of "right sides" together!! But in the end, I did get it right and got it finished!!




This "Little Wallet" goes together sew fast! I did make one change to the pattern by adding another section 2 and stitching in from each side ( leaving the middle open) and it will be able to hold coins!!




The pattern uses a snap, but I rather have Velcro! I made 2 of these yesterday in 30 minutes or less!!
